In 2015, the hockey team won its first state championship. Harold “Jr.” McIlwain ('93) won the 400m in 1992 PIAA state track championships and followed that with the 800m title in 1993. Holy Ghost Preparatory School also added a rowing team in fall 2015. In the fall of 2020, Holy Ghost Prep left the Bicentennial Athletic League.

Blackrock College was founded by the Holy Ghost Fathers in 1860. Rockwell College was founded in 1864 and is located near Cashel, County Tipperary. St. Michael's College, Dublin, was bought by Blackrock College in 1944 as a second feeder school with Willow Park. In December 1970, St Michael's officially became independent from Blackrock College.

Saint Charles Preparatory School is a four-year Catholic college preparatory school in Columbus, Ohio, US. It was founded in 1923 by the fourth bishop of Columbus, James J. Hartley, as a Roman Catholic college and high school seminary. [4] Today, it is an all-male high school serving the Catholic Diocese of Columbus.
